The Cook County Jail, located on 96acre in Cook County, Illinois, is the largest jail in the United States of America, housing approximately 9,000 men and women. The facility is located at 2600 South California Avenue in the city of Chicago. It employs 3,900 law enforcement officials and 7,000 civilian employees.The prison has held several well-known and infamous criminals, including Jayson Delisle, Tony Accardo, Frank Nitti, Larry Hoover, Jeff Fort, Richard Speck, John Wayne Gacy and the Chicago Seven. It was one of three sites in which executions were carried out by electrocution in Illinois. Between 1928 and 1962, the electric chair was used 67 times at the jail, including the state's last electrocution of James Duke on August 24, 1962. The state's other electrocutions were carried out at the Stateville Correctional Center in Crest Hill and at the Menard Correctional Center in Chester.
